Log Home on the Blackfoot River
With classic Montana views, lots of wildlife, plenty of acreage to stretch your legs, a quiet end of the road location, a gorgeous, very comfortable, well-maintained log home and an incredible amount of easy-to-access river frontage on one of the West's crown jewel rivers, the Blackfoot, we welcome you to our Blackfoot home.
Equally appealing for a private getaway for couples or a perfect base location for families looking for an outdoor getaway, our fully furnished cabin checks every box.
Comfortable accommodations? Yes. The perfect level of coziness mixed with function. The cabin is highly efficient with thick walls for fantastic temperature regulation. Plenty of windows provide tons of natural light and allow you to open it up for as much fresh air as you like. The cabin has incredible views out to the neighboring public lands and river views. Big couches and chairs allow you to relax and take it all in. A killer wrap around deck allows you to enjoy the epic down valley sunsets and welcoming beds will ensure a quality night's sleep so you can get after it the next day...or sleep in until you feel like getting up.
Privacy and quiet location? Yes, located at the end of a private ranch road your neighbors will be deer, elk, coyotes, prairie dogs, sandhill cranes and other birds and the occasional bear.
Room to stretch your legs? Yes, located on 35 acres you'll have grassy flats, sage and wildflower benches, pine and juniper groves, and gorgeous cottonwood stands...and the river. If you want to do more exploring, once you're within the high water mark of the Blackfoot's banks, legally you can wander for miles up or down the river bed.
Is the river safe? Yes, but always exercise caution with water. The river is extremely accessible to adults and children provided children are accompanied by an adult. The river is braided out beautifully in this stretch and it makes for wonderful fishing spots, rock collecting, making mud pies, skipping stones, or just lounging in the sun listening to the current and cottonwood leaves. Please note, the river can go subsurface, that is, it "runs dry". In a typical year, this happens towards the end of August and is totally out of anyone's control other than Mother Nature.
How far from town? As secluded and private as the property is, the town of Lincoln is only about a 7 minute drive away on a well maintained road. You might see elk, deer, cranes, geese and maybe a bear on your way to town.
Bears? Yes. This section of the Blackfoot Valley in and around the Lincoln area is well known for its healthy grizzly bear population. While an encounter is unlikely, please bring bear spray if you go down to the river or for a hike in the nearby national forest.
